Elizabeth Holloway Sheppard

December 18, 1923 - May 18, 2009

Elizabeth Holloway Sheppard

ELIZABETH HOLLOWAY SHEPPARD, 85, of Valdosta, passed away Monday, May 18, 2009, at her home.

She was born in Huntington, WV, a daughter of the late Charles and Olive Harper Holloway. Mrs. Sheppard had taught elementary school in the Savannah-Chatham County School System, later becoming a librarian. She retired from Volusia County School System, Daytona Beach, FL, as a librarian. She and her husband, Joseph Davis Sheppard, moved to Valdosta in 1985. Mr. Sheppard died in 1999.

Mrs. Sheppard had deep Christian faith within herself, was very religious and had attended several local churches. She enjoyed working in the yard and garden, reading and boating.
